Output 7feda114a62e258ac09038a8acc5408334fc0108a256afe28f6951bcf6b4ac2a:4

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 5cfa2117de184420557273fb35f027acb10a41ba
address
bc1qtnazz977rpzzq4tjw0antup84jcs5sd6udh2gw
transaction
7feda114a62e258ac09038a8acc5408334fc0108a256afe28f6951bcf6b4ac2a
spent
true